Restaurant at Agarvada, Goa

Who doesn’t love Goan heritage? There’s indeed something timeless about its earthy textures, slow rhythms, and sunlit charm. So when we began our restaurant design near the historic Chapora Fort, we knew our inspiration lay right here in Goa itself.

Our vision was simple; We just wanted to create a Goan restaurant that celebrates the region’s spirit with the vibrant flavors of South Indian cuisine. We wanted a space that feels rooted, relaxed, warm, sustainable and full of life like Goa’s own soul. That’s why the all natural, local building materials palette of laterite, bamboo and traditional thatch. And then, the boundary landscaping further enlivened this ambiance with a feeling as inviting as the food itself.

You know, we didn’t just think of it just as a standout among South Indian restaurants in Goa. We did try to make it as a living testament to how authentic local aesthetics can truly elevate a dining experience with eco-conscious hospitality.

Year : 2023

Location : Agarvada, Goa

Plot Area : 560 sq.m

Built-Up Area : 140 sq.m
